Subject: On-call handover — payment retry idempotency

Hi Rielle, handing over mid-incident. The Coinward retry worker is generating fresh idempotency keys on each retry instead of reusing the original, so a handful of customers were double-charged overnight. I've paused automatic retries and tagged affected transactions for refund review. The fix is in review; don't re-enable retries until it ships. If support needs status updates, direct them to the payments on-call at the address below.

escalation mailbox, bafog-fafog: ulador@paliqlabs.internal

Ticket: Retention sweeper misconfigured in staging

The Grainfall data-retention sweeper skipped last night's run. Root cause: the staging env file was copied from a dev snapshot and is missing two vars. The sweeper silently exits when its purge window is unset, which is why no alerts fired — I've added a startup check so it now fails loudly. Reviewer: please confirm the fixed env file. PURGE_WINDOW_DAYS is set to 30. The sweeper's auth secret comes immediately after that line:

sealed setting: COURIER_KEY29=170ad45524657711572101e080d15

Handover — Spectra contrast audit

For new joiners: the Spectra service audits color contrast across the Hollowell design system nightly and files tickets for failures. Thresholds follow WCAG AA, with an AAA mode gated behind a flag. Keep the palette snapshot fresh or results skew. Everything it does is driven by the configuration values listed below.

settings of fafog-haduf:
ZORIX_PIN=4648
ZORIX_METRICS_HOST=metrics.zorix.paliqsys.corp
ZORIX_LOG_LEVEL=info
ZORIX_TENANT=druix

Handover: Bramblefn cold starts

Taking over from me: the Bramblefn serverless handlers cold-start around 4s on the first invoke after idle. Pre-warming pinger runs every 10 min but misses the payments handler. Provisioned concurrency is half-configured; finish it before the Harvale launch. Logs show init time dominated by the schema loader. The settings I was testing with are listed below.

deployment values, kajep-kageg:
[praix]
host = praix.paliqcorp.corp
user = praix_svc
database = praix_prod